使用PowerDesigner建立概念模型并自动生成逻辑数据模型

使用PowerDesigner建立概念模型

1.打开PowerDesigner

​ File——>New Model——>Model types——>Conceptual Data Model——>Conceptual Diagram
在这里插入图片描述

2.将Model name换为:(目的名称)CDM

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-H3kjEFB0-1610100314611)(材料\2.png)]

3.建立项目后,发现Conceptual Diagram中有一些项不能用,设置

​ Tools——>Model Options

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-p310fZUo-1610100314615)(材料\3.png)]

4.创建实体

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-RIasaDFy-1610100314619)(材料\4.jpg)]

双击进入实体,设置

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

5.创建联系(无属性)

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-bTslI4rG-1610100314623)(材料\8.jpg)]

双击进行设置

在这里插入图片描述
在这里插入图片描述

6.建立连接(有属性)

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-vl504pcQ-1610100314625)(材料\11.jpg)]

双击进行设置

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

7.检查

​ Tools——>Check Model

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-kosI9PQD-1610100314628)(材料\16.png)]

确定

8.最终效果

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-2ZCQ0eVV-1610100314628)(材料\17.png)]

利用Powerdesigner将概念模型自动生成逻辑数据模型

1.Tools——>Generate Logical Data Model

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-nlboLmES-1610100314629)(材料\18.png)]

修改名称

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-Spv2RkJJ-1610100314629)(材料\19.png)]

确定

2.效果

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-1U0bUBeO-1610100314630)(材料\20.png)]

  • 17
    点赞
  • 104
    收藏
    觉得还不错? 一键收藏
  • 2
    评论
### 回答1: 要在PowerDesigner建立概念模型,可以按照以下步骤进行操作: 1. 打开PowerDesigner软件,选择“新建模型”。 2. 在弹出的对话框中选择“概念模型”类型,然后点击“确定”。 3. 在新建的概念模型中,可以通过工具栏上的各种工具来创建实体、属性、关系等元素。 4. 在创建实体时,需要为实体命名,并定义实体的属性。 5. 在创建关系时,需要选择两个实体,并定义它们之间的关系类型。 6. 完成概念模型的创建后,可以保存模型并导出为各种格式的文件。 以上是在PowerDesigner建立概念模型的基本步骤,具体操作还需要根据实际情况进行调整和优化。 ### 回答2: PowerDesigner是一个流程建模和数据建模的软件工具,用于制作企业级的概念模型概念模型是一个形式抽象的四象限图,包含所有企业领域的主概念、关系、实体、属性以及它们之间的联系。在PowerDesigner中,建立概念模型的主要步骤如下: 1. 创建项目:打开PowerDesigner,在“文件”菜单上选择“新建”,选择一个空白的概念模型项目。 2. 创建实体和属性:在概念模型的画布上,通过“实体”和“属性”工具创建实体和属性。实体是领域中的概念对象,属性是实体的特征和属性。 3. 创建关系:通过“关系”工具创建实体之间的关系。有三种关系类型:一对一、一对多和多对多。 4. 命名和标注:给实体和属性命名,为对象和关系添加标注。 5. 补充可见性和约束:通过“可见性”和“约束”工具对概念模型进行补充。可见性表示对象是否能被其他对象看见,约束表示对象之间的限制条件。 6. 导入数据:如有必要,可以直接将数据导入PowerDesigner中,以此为基础创建概念模型。 7. 生成脚本:通过“脚本生成”功能生成数据定义语言(DDL)脚本,供数据库管理员使用。 总的来说,PowerDesigner是一个优秀的制作概念模型的工具,可以帮助用户更好地理解企业的数据结构和业务流程。建立一个正确的概念模型,是企业设计合理的信息系统和建立高附加值的产品的基础。 ### 回答3: PowerDesigner是一款功能强大的数据库建模工具,在企业应用系统建设中得到广泛应用。其中的概念模型是其最基础的建模形式,通过对概念模型建立可以对业务的本质进行分析、抽象和建立,是进行后续物理设计和开发的重要基础。 PowerDesigner建立概念模型的步骤主要可以分为以下几个方面: 1. 路径选择:在打开PowerDesigner软件后,选择“新建概念模型”选项,进入概念模型编辑界面。 2. 创建主题区域:一个概念模型中通常会存储多个主题,如“客户”、“订单”等,需要先创建主题区域,并将其命名,比如可以创建“销售管理”。 3. 添加实体:在“销售管理”区域下,选择“实体”图标,添加相关实体的信息,如名称、简介、主键等。 4. 划分属性:通过对实体进行属性划分,可以进一步描述实体的特征和属性。属性分为标识属性、数据属性、描述性属性等若干类别,需要输入属性名称、数据类型、长度、是否可空等相关信息。 5. 建立联系:在概念模型中,各实体之间的联系起到非常重要的作用,需要建立相关联系,如一对一、一对多、多对多等联系方式,建立联系时需要选择合适的联系方式,并设置相应的属性信息。 6. 特化和泛化:在一些情况下,概念模型需要进行特化和泛化操作,通过将实体进行分类并派生出新实体,可以更好地描述业务需求和实现业务目标。 7. 细化概念模型:在建立概念模型之后,需要对其进行细化和完善,包括对模型进行检视和修改、对通用性进行考虑和调整、对需求和变更进行解决等方面。 PowerDesigner建立概念模型的过程需要充分了解业务需求和系统设计原则,并结合实际的业务情况进行操作。建立好的概念模型可以为后续物理设计和开发提供重要的支持和依据,对企业应用建设具有重要的作用和意义。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值